Claude finds your data, picks the action that means "this user got value", and
writes the report. No events table needed — your orders table already is one:
SELECT user_id, created_at::date AS date, 'purchase' AS event FROM orders
UNION ALL
SELECT user_id, added_at::date, 'add_to_wishlist' FROM wishlist_items
Nothing tracked yet? Say "add the tracking I'm missing" and Claude reads your
code, writes the logging that's absent, and tells you when to come back.

Why this exists
DAU/MAU charts go "up and to the right" as long as new users arrive — even when
nobody stays. Until you have hundreds of users, the most informative dashboard is
YC's dot plot (David Lieb):
one row per user, one cell per day.
Four rules keep it honest:
- Code computes, AI only interprets — same data, same numbers, every time
- Small samples withhold judgment — under 5 users in a group, it says nothing
- Correlation isn't cause — every finding ships with "test this before you believe it"
- Vanity metrics are refused — pick
open_app as your value event and the code says no
Reports come out in your language (English, 한국어, 日本語 built in; anything else
translated on the fly with the numbers verified intact).
